Citizens Mutual Fund-1 (CMF1) a 7-year closed-end mutual fund scheme has published its monthly report for the month of Asadh, 2076.

As per the report, a mutual fund has reported a minimal increase in Net Assets Value (NAV) to Rs 11.35 from Rs 11.34. The scheme, which began with a fund size of Rs 82 crore has invested Rs 67.41 crore in the shares of listed companies and Rs 8.03 crore in non-listed shares.

This scheme has invested Rs 8 crore in fixed deposit and has Rs 10.22 crore in the bank balance.

The mutual fund is the first mutual fund of CBIL Capital. The scheme is managed by CBIL Capital with Citizens Bank International as the fund sponsor.

It has reported a net profit of Rs 9.26 crore till Asadh which was Rs 9.20 crore till the last month.

Citizens Mutual Fund-2 (CMF2) is CBIL Capital Limited second mutual fund scheme, and is a 7-years closed-end fund. The recently launched scheme has published its NAV report for the month of Asadh, 2076.

As per the report, a mutual fund has reported Net Assets Value (NAV) of Rs 9.92 till Asadh end. The scheme, which began with a fund size of Rs 1 arba hasn’t invested yet in the shares of listed companies or non-listed companies.

This scheme has invested Rs 2 crore in fixed deposit and has Rs 54.18 crore in the bank balance.

The scheme is managed by CBIL Capital with Citizens Bank International as the fund sponsor.

It has reported a net loss of Rs 42.03 Lakhs till Asadh end.
